Chief of Staff to the Enterprise GM

💸 Salary: $179,000 - $290,000

🔍 Industry: Work marketplace

🗣️ Languages: English

Requirements:
  • Extensive knowledge of enterprise go-to-market organizations
  • Unquestionable ethics and integrity, a track record of impeccable judgment and doing the right thing even when nobody would know if you chose the easy alternative
  • Exceptional written and oral communication skills that enable preparation of both numeric and narrative driven keynotes, bod work, all hands, presentations, memos for a range of audiences
  • Track record of cross-functional leadership & comfort partnering with finance, legal, hr, marketing, product, engineering etc
  • To meet the organization’s needs
  • Outstanding financial acumen and understanding of short and long term implications of decisions to lead long range planning, budget creation and management, as well as ongoing resource allocation and projections
  • Consultative mindset to weigh the opportunities and costs of key investments
  • Excellent program/project management skills with the ability to drive multiple complex strategic and operational initiatives simultaneously
  • Ability to think strategically from first principles while leading with a sense of urgency through ambiguities
  • Proven history of collaboration and positive cultural impact in a distributed team
  • Bias for action and a mentality that no job is too big or too small to be done the right way.
Responsibilities:
  • Manage strategic planning, budgeting processes, and executive communication preparation
  • Work with leaders to develop okrs, ensure alignment & support measurement
  • Lead a small team of program managers to provide oversight of business unit initiatives
  • Manage rhythm and business unit cadences & align to company cadences
  • Maximize the time of the enterprise leadership team and the enterprise gm
  • Drive feedback loops & strengthen integration across the business unit and organization
  • Lead continuous improvement in processes, tools, & cadences
  • Support & champion continuous operational improvement and exploration
  • Partner with leaders to build processes and structures that can scale with the company & business unit’s growth
  • Incubation of new initiatives as appropriate and then spinning them off to other teams, or winding them down entirely and integrating our findings to future efforts
  • Advocating for all enterprise priorities, from product to sales to solutions to talent, especially when their leaders are not in the room
  • Being a thought partner to the enterprise gm.
